44 R E S O L U T I O N
55 WHEREAS, Kirbie Day of Maypearl was named National Polled
66 Hereford Queen on January 17, 2009, during the National Western
77 Stock Show in Denver; and
88 WHEREAS, Ms. Day was one of the youngest participants in the
99 National Polled Hereford Queen competition, where she impressed the
1010 judges with her poise, her past achievements in breeding, raising,
1111 and showing Herefords, and her wide diversity of interests; as
1212 queen, she will attend the national shows in Fort Worth, Denver,
1313 Reno, Keystone, Pennsylvania, Kansas City, and Louisville; her
1414 duties include serving as an ambassador for the breed and the State
1515 of Texas and presenting awards at the livestock shows; and
1616 WHEREAS, The daughter of proud parents Paul and KayLynn Day,
1717 Ms. Day was encouraged by her father to raise and show heifers and
1818 bulls; often competing against seasoned ranchers, she has a
1919 phenomenal record of success, earning 25 grand champions and the
2020 National Premier Exhibition Award for the show bull, the show
2121 heifer, and premier exhibitor at an event in Kansas City, Missouri;
2222 and
2323 WHEREAS, Ms. Day is also a talented student and athlete;
2424 currently a senior at Maypearl High School, she is a member of the
2525 National Honor Society, ranks in the top 10 percent of her class,
2626 and serves the student body as vice president; in addition, she has
2727 received all-district honors in softball and excelled in track and
2828 volleyball; and
2929 WHEREAS, The proud owner of 30 head of Hereford cattle, Ms.
3030 Day has already accumulated 36 hours of college credit and is
3131 involved in embryo transplant work with Dr. Brad Stoud; her
3232 academic goals include attending Texas A&M University, where she
3333 plans to major in animal science and focus on embryo research; she
3434 intends to minor in business and ultimately have a career as an
3535 animal pharmacist or embryo scientist; and
3636 WHEREAS, Ms. Day's title of National Polled Hereford Queen
3737 has been hard earned, and her dedication, ambition, and many
3838 accomplishments foretell a bright future; now, therefore, be it
3939 R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 81st Texas
4040 Legislature hereby congratulate Kirbie Day on earning the title of
4141 National Polled Hereford Queen and extend to her sincere best
4242 wishes for continued success in all of her endeavors; and, be it
4343 further
4444 R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be
4545 prepared for Ms. Day as an expression of high regard by the Texas
4646 House of Representatives.
